Birthday Girl
2002 · Jez Butterworth · Steve Butterworth | Diana Phillips · 1 hr 33 min
A thirtysomething bank clerk from St Albans has his small-town life exploded by the arrival of his Russian mail-order bride.

| Category | Year | Reported | Inflation Adjusted |
|---|---|---|---|
| Domestic Domestic theatrical box office gross. | 2002 | $5,142,576 | $9,201,752 |
| International International theatrical box office gross. | 2002 | $11,028,522 | $19,733,637 |
| Worldwide Combined worldwide theatrical box office gross. | 2002 | $16,171,098 | $28,198,296 |
